Written by Julian Louis Lamothe, Produced by Paul M. Powell. Released November 4th, 1915. Cast: L. C. Shumway as Robert Grant — the detective, Sidney Hayes as The British Ambassador, Robert Gray as Stream — his secretary, George Routh as Nami — another ambassador, Melvin Mayo as Beltros — the chemist — his spy, Velma Whitman as Selene — the adventuress, Neva Gerber as Myra Hamilton — the teacher.
